We had already booked the Ruby Princess for a 7 day cruise Dec. 2014. When I saw this cruise with the 100% credit toward a 7 day or more 2014 cruise we had to jump on it.

I treated my Mom to this cruise as a surprise, especially since I told her only 4 days before we left. We live in Orlando, Fl. and drove down the evening before and arrived in Ft. Lauderdale about 9:15 pm. We stayed at the Rodeway Inn with their stay/park/cruise package. We settled in for the night.

Saturday, 1/9/2014 was embarkation day. I woke up at 6 am and we had breakfast at 7:30 am. I always have a ritual that if I am not in a hotel that has a view of the ship that I drive to it prior to boarding. Definitely gets my adrenaline going even after 75+ cruises. Mom wanted to go and so we did. Even though it was lightly raining the beautiful Ruby Princess was at Terminal 2 closest to the 17th Street bridge. I filled the car up with gas so it would be ready for when we returned home. Went back to the hotel and waited until the shuttle took us to the ship at 11 am.

Cabin Review

Actually it is called a B1 now. Standard outside cabin but with the large 9x9 balcony since it was on Caribe deck. It is half covered/uncovered. This was close to elevator which was great since I was pushing Mom in wheelchair part of the time. Even though the actual cabin is on the small side the "walk-in" closet was perfect for storing Mom's wheelchair. The balcony had two regular chairs and two chairs with the fold-down backs. Needless to say we used two off the chairs for ottomans. There was also a table. Balcony was nice to have a drink or breakfast on.
